Problem 59P

Lasers for Fusion Two of the most powerful lasers in the world are used in nuclear fusion experiments. The NOVA laser produces 40.0 kJ of energy in a pulse that lasts 2.50 ns, and the N1F laser (under construction) will produce a 10.0-ns pulse with 3.00 MJ of energy. (a) Which laser produces more energy in each pulse? (b) Which laser produces the greater average power during each pulse? (c) If the beam diameters are the same, which laser produces the greater average intensity?
